Kuaijishan Shaoxing Rice Wine
Kuaijishan Shaoxing Rice Wine Co., Ltd. engages in the research and development, production, and sale of rice wine under the Kuaijishan, Wuzhengmao, Xitang, and Tangsong brands. in China and internationally. The company sells a small amount of fermented liquor by-products. Kuaijishan Shaoxing Rice Wine Co., Ltd. was incorporated in 1993 and is headquartered in Shaoxing, China.

Annual Total Assets for Kuaijishan Shaoxing Rice Wine (2009–2024)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Kuaijishan Shaoxing Rice Wine from 2009 to 2024.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2024-12-31 | CN¥4.56 Billion | +0.78% |
| 2023-12-31 | CN¥4.53 Billion | -0.19% |
| 2022-12-31 | CN¥4.54 Billion | +1.24% |
| 2021-12-31 | CN¥4.48 Billion | +0.41% |
| 2020-12-31 | CN¥4.46 Billion | -1.40% |
| 2019-12-31 | CN¥4.53 Billion | +3.90% |
| 2018-12-31 | CN¥4.36 Billion | +9.02% |
| 2017-12-31 | CN¥4.00 Billion | +7.99% |
| 2016-12-31 | CN¥3.70 Billion | +52.27% |
| 2015-12-31 | CN¥2.43 Billion | +11.40% |
| 2014-12-31 | CN¥2.18 Billion | +5.43% |
| 2013-12-31 | CN¥2.07 Billion | +11.46% |
| 2012-12-31 | CN¥1.86 Billion | +8.30% |
| 2011-12-31 | CN¥1.71 Billion | +11.89% |
| 2010-12-31 | CN¥1.53 Billion | -8.60% |
| 2009-12-31 | CN¥1.68 Billion | -- |
